Palestinian leader Yasser Arafat on Tuesday said without the efforts of Egypt, the Palestinians would never reach a Hudna (ceasefire) with Israel.

Arafat made the remarks to reporters following a meeting with Egyptian President Hosni Mubarak's envoy Omar Suleiman at his headquarters in the West Bank city of Ramallah.

Palestinian Prime Minister Mahmoud Abbas also attended the meeting which was described as "fruitful and encouraging" by Palestinian officials.

Arafat said the efforts of all parties -- the Palestinians, Arableaders, the United States, Europe, Russia and China -- would continue to guarantee the accurate implementation of the roadmap peace plan.

During the talks, Palestinian officials and Suleiman discussed every detail of the developments linked to the roadmap leading to an independent Palestinian state by 2005, Arafat told reporters after the meeting.
